PostgreSQL 中的代码检查
本主题列出了 PostgreSQL 中可用的所有 PhpStorm 代码检查。
您可以在编辑器 |上切换特定检查或更改其严重性级别。IDE 设置的检查Ctrl+Alt+S页面。
检查 | 描述 | 默认严重性 |
---|---|---|
报告当您从函数或 DBLINK 进行 SELECT 时的情况,而没有带别名的类型(例如, CREATE FUNCTIONproduce_a_table() RETURNS RECORD AS $$ SELECT 1; $$ 语言 sql; SELECT * FROM producer_a_table() AS s (c1 INT); SELECT * FROM producer_a_table() AS s (c1); SELECT * FROM DBLINK('dbname=mydb', 'SELECT proname, prosrc FROM pg_proc') AS t1; TheAS s (c1 INT) 有一个类型化的别名,whileAS s (c1) 和AS t1 do 没有。在这种情况下,第二次调用produce_a_table() andDBLINK() 将被突出显示。 | 警告 |
最后修改:2022 年 2 月 11 日